Good for dog and cat food, and basic pet supplies, not so good for actual animals. When we started our aquarium, we got some of our fish from here, and all of them died within a couple months. In comparison, the same kinds of fish we got from a dedicated aquarium store are alive and thriving at 6+ months. This is not at all a mark on the employees, this is a corporate thing! The staff here love animals, and have little to no control over what animals they receive, but do their best to take care of them. Occasionally you’ll find someone who’s got a particular specialty and can give some really good advice. However, they’re chronically understaffed, and have a high turnover rate, there’s little to no specialty training on how to care for anything other than dogs and cats, and a lot of their information on that is coming from Brand reps who are pushing them to sell their products. Get info from your vet on what food is right for your pet, and then come buy it here for a good price. If you’re just starting out with a new pet, get startup supplies here, but if you really want to make sure your birds, reptiles, or fish are getting the best care, go to a specialty local store instead of a big box chain.
